Henry Buckles, age 66, of Regina, SK, Canada passed away on June 7, 2026 in Regina.

Hank had a lot of pride and dignity. He was a private man, honest, loyal, full of determination, loved writing poems, and had a beautiful singing voice! He was a great father, husband, Poppy, friend, brother, uncle, nephew, and cousin. The family wishes to inform you that Hank followed the Catholic religion as his girls were baptized by the Church, and he respected his traditional ways. With Hank's health declining over the last few years, he still took time to enjoy life to the fullest with his baby, Kahteri (Kahturn), and the babies he helped raise: Jax (Jaxsi), Luxanna (Yaya) and Baby Brexton (Bushbomb Luscious Aloysius Bixby). If you knew Hank, he was good at giving nicknames like he did with his kids, grandkids, and relatives. We will never forget the man he was, the love we shared, and We will love and miss him forever.
